Before I read through the MS Newsgroups etc I just thought I'd see if anyone else has experienced this with Office/Outlook 2007.

If I try and do a New Mail Message I get the following error on screen:

Cannot create the e-mail message because a data file to send and receive messages cannot be found. To add a data file, such as a personal folder file, double-click the Mail icon in Windows Control Panel. Outlook cannot open this item. The item may be damaged.

It only happens when you do a "New Mail Message".
If you do new contact, note, meeting request, appointment etc then that works fine.
I'm receiving mail just fine through Outlook, just obviously cannot use Outlook to send mail.

If I open a mail message and attempt to either reply or forward it I get the following error:

The messaging interface has returned an unknown error. If this problem persists, restart Outlook. Outlook cannot open this item. The item may be damaged

Any ideas at all?
